Abstract

The utility model relates to a plant conservation type respiratory membrane which comprises a respiratory membrane body and is characterized in that a plant accommodating through hole is formed in the center of the respiratory membrane body; a ring-shaped bearing respiratory zone is arranged around the plant accommodating through hole; and breathing pores are distributed on the respiratory zone. The ring-shaped bearing respiratory zone is used for bearing soil, rock or other covering objects. Owing to the distributed breathing pores, plant roots are prevented from breathing obstructions caused by the weight or distribution of the covering objects; and moreover, water penetration is better facilitated, and a plant is prevented from absorbing water excessively or the moisture of roots is prevented from evaporating excessively, thus improving the global conservation effect. Besides, the plant conservation type respiratory membrane is simple in structure, can be produced by processing a conventional respiratory membrane and is easy to popularize.

Embodiment
Plant maintenance type respiratory membrane as shown in Figure 1 includes the respiratory membrane body, and its unusual part is: the respiratory membrane body center that the utility model adopts offers plant receiving opening 1.Thus, can keep the needed free space of root growth of plant.Simultaneously, around plant receiving opening 1, be distributed with annular carrying breathing zone 2, and be distributed with spiracle 3 on the annular carrying breathing zone 2.Like this, screen body such as the soil that needs in the time of can allowing the 2 carrying plant maintenances of annular carrying breathing zone or stone, and can not stop up upper layer of soil because of the weight of screen body and distribution, influence plant respiration.
With regard to the utility model one preferred implementation, consider the infiltration needs of water, do not influence the needs that root system of plant is breathed simultaneously, the spiracle 3 of employing is ellipse hole (also comprising circular hole).Certainly, consider different plant variety needs, also can adopt the crescent through hole, enlarge air permeable effect, guarantee not have too many water simultaneously and flow into.And, can also adopt Pear-Shaped, improve the ventilated effect of regional area, promote the growth needs at night of certain plants.
Further, lack the plant of shaded surface body for some, occur easily that the respiratory membrane body is subjected to displacement or curl, influence result of use.For this reason, the annular carrying breathing zone 2 of the utility model employing is provided with Sash fastener 4.Like this, cooperate relevant screw by Sash fastener 4, can not influence use effectively with the utility model location on the ground.
Again further, in order to satisfy the growth needs of plant, the diameter of its trunk of fitting is provided with between plant receiving opening 1 and annular carrying breathing zone 2 and tightens locating ring 5.Thus, can prevent too much gap, the problem that causes the water transition to be infiltrated.
